1. Master the Art of Networking

Networking is a powerful tool for career advancement. As an HR recruiter, your ability to connect with people can open up new pathways for professional development. Attend industry conferences, webinars, and workshops to meet other professionals and share insights on recruitment trends. Joining HR recruiter-specific forums and associations can also be invaluable. Building a robust professional network can lead to opportunities for collaboration and advancement.

Tips for Effective Networking

  • Be genuine: Authenticity builds stronger connections.
  • Follow-up: Stay in touch with your connections regularly.
  • Offer value: Share useful resources and insights.

2. Enhance Your Educational Qualifications

Advanced educational qualifications can set you apart in the competitive HR landscape. Consider pursuing certifications like the Professional in Human Resources (PHR) or the Senior Professional in Human Resources (SPHR). These certifications are recognized globally and indicate a high level of competency in HR practices.

3. Develop Strategic Thinking Abilities

Moving beyond operational tasks to a strategic role requires the ability to think and plan at an organizational level. HR recruiters should focus on understanding larger business goals and aligning their recruitment strategies with these objectives. Strategic thinking will not only enhance your value within the company but also position you for leadership roles.

Consider engaging in strategic management courses or workshops that highlight how to apply strategic thinking within the HR function. Practicing scenario analysis and feasibility studies adds an edge to your strategic capabilities.


4. Embrace Technology and Data Analytics

Advancements in technology and the adoption of data analytics have revolutionized recruitment processes. HR recruiters who are proficient in leveraging data-driven insights have a significant advantage. Familiarize yourself with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S), HR analytics tools, and other recruiting software that optimize the recruitment process. Gain skills in using data to make informed decisions, understand labor market trends, and enhance the recruitment strategy.

Essential Tech Skills for HR Recruiters

  • Data analytics: Use data insights to enhance recruitment processes.
  • Social media recruiting: Harness platforms like LinkedIn for sourcing candidates.
  • Digital interviewing tools: Conduct seamless remote interviews.

5. Cultivate Leadership Skills

The ability to lead and inspire a team is a crucial component for career advancement. HR recruiters aspiring to move up the ladder should focus on developing their leadership abilities. Leadership training programs can provide valuable insights into managing teams, resolving conflicts, and driving productivity without compromising on employee satisfaction.

Key Leadership Skills

  • Communication: Articulate vision and goals clearly.
  • Empathy: Understand and manage employees’ needs and aspirations.
  • Decision-making: Make informed and effective decisions swiftly.
